When evaluating a microsurvey tool, several core functionalities are non-negotiable for professional growth teams. First is logic branching, which ensures that a user’s second question is relevant to their first answer. Second is visual customization; the survey should look like a native part of your UI, not a clunky third-party pop-up. Finally, look for robust integration capabilities with platforms like Slack, Salesforce, or Mixpanel so that feedback can trigger automated workflows. A SaaS company notices users dropping off during the setup phase. By implementing a microsurvey tool that triggers when a user clicks "Back" or closes the window during onboarding, the tool asks: "What is preventing you from setting up your account?"
